Output 66833fc8b1db6b714b2eb79eef9b43e6a6c8fdda2944cbdcefe0ac5a3fd15797:0

value
12604141
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b74a543dbd26abb66ccce54ec58d45956e8dfb4c OP_EQUALVERIFY OP_CHECKSIG
address
Lbw6xntsbzrjvT81mZz4yEJABSKhJr8xFk
transaction
66833fc8b1db6b714b2eb79eef9b43e6a6c8fdda2944cbdcefe0ac5a3fd15797
spent
true